Ticket solving
A ticket board that runs the whole loop: file → solve → review → resolve, with a live step-by-step activity trail and an always-available conversation to guide or approve the solve.
Playbooks
Versioned, evolving how-to-solve runbooks per recurring task type - with router triggers, changelogs, and a maturity ladder (draft → tested → automatable) that is the automation roadmap.
Knowledge library
A permissioned library organized by folder → module → content. Hybrid keyword + semantic retrieval, auto-categorization of uploaded documents, and scope-gating on everything it returns.
Approvals
When Kairo proposes a playbook change or a query to run, it lands in Approvals for someone with write access - shown as a GitHub-style diff, with a stale badge if the playbook moved on.
People & access
Onboard a person, assign modules (role/team/domain/product), and they inherit that scope's knowledge. Roles and levels gate what each member sees - manager content stays manager-only.
Tool execution (MCP)
Register real MCP tools - a read-only analytics warehouse, Sheets, an HTTP action - and grant each module a mode: draft only, needs approval, or auto-run. Writes are never auto-executed.
Search
Search across tickets, playbooks, and knowledge - results grouped by type, filterable, clickable, and scope-gated to your modules. Try it with a phrase like 'autodebit mandate failure'.
Dashboards
What needs attention, how the system is learning, and per-solve metrics - tokens, time, tool calls, redundant work saved. Measured on every run, visible everywhere.
Plug-and-play LLM
Any OpenAI-compatible endpoint - bring your own model and key, encrypted at rest, configured per organization in Settings. Swappable embeddings too.
One wrapped system, not a bag of features.
Every capability talks to the same interfaces - a single model layer, a single retrieval layer, a single permission model. That's why onboarding is inheritance: assign the modules for a role and a new hire gets everything the system already knows about that work.
